Aider: Command-Line AI Pair Programming Tool
Aider: Command-Line AI Pair Programming Tool
Aider is a unique open-source command-line tool that transforms your terminal into an AI pair programming environment. Unlike most AI coding assistants that operate within IDEs, aider works directly with your local Git repositories.
Features
Terminal-Based AI Programming
Operates entirely through the command line, providing AI assistance directly in your terminal environment.
Git Repository Integration
Works seamlessly with your existing Git repositories, understanding project structure and version control history.
Open Source
Completely open-source tool that can be customized and extended according to your needs.
Local Development Focus
Designed for local development workflows, integrating with your existing file system and tools.
Pair Programming Experience
Mimics the experience of pair programming with an AI assistant that understands your codebase.
Context-Aware Assistance
Understands your entire project context through Git repository analysis.
Key Capabilities
- File Modification: Direct file editing and creation through AI commands
- Git Workflow: Automatic commit generation and version control integration
- Project Understanding: Analyzes entire codebase for context-aware suggestions
- Terminal Integration: Works with existing terminal-based development workflows
Best For
- Developers who prefer command-line interfaces
- Open-source enthusiasts
- Git-centric development workflows
- Terminal-based development environments
- Developers seeking local AI assistance without cloud dependencies
- Programmers who enjoy pair programming approaches
- Teams with existing CLI-heavy workflows
Last built with the static site tool.